Meet Marjorie McIntyre the retail manager at St Teresa’s Hospice in Darlington. I’ve been asked to start taking a look through the donations made to the charity to spot any likely antiques that might tell an interesting historical story and sell well in auction to raise funds for the hospice.
Hopefully, more videos to follow as we develop a system of char king antiques as they come in
